Top Sustainable Technologies Transforming the‌ Classroom

Let’s ‍dive into the ‌leading eco-friendly innovations that are reshaping schools worldwide.

1.​ Solar-Powered Smart Classrooms

  • Solar panels supply clean,renewable energy for lighting,heating,air conditioning,and powering devices.
  • Cut utility bills and reduce reliance on fossil fuels for ⁢a more sustainable school ‌infrastructure.
  • Schools can integrate real-time solar energy dashboards into science curriculums, teaching⁢ students about green ⁤energy production⁢ and⁣ management.

2. Interactive Digital Learning Platforms

  • Devices like tablets and e-readers replace customary paper textbooks—dramatically ‌lowering paper waste.
  • Cloud-based learning management systems ​(LMS) centralize resources​ and assignments, ‍streamlining collaboration while ⁣using minimal physical materials.
  • Many​ platforms now ⁤feature bright energy-saving modes and recycled-material casings,‍ further enhancing sustainability.

3. IoT Sensors ⁣and Smart Building⁣ Systems

  • Intelligent​ HVAC,‌ lighting,⁢ and occupancy sensors ⁣ adjust automatically based on classroom usage, slashing ‌energy waste.
  • Monitor air quality, temperature, humidity, and even⁢ noise levels in real-time‌ for optimal learning environments and well-being.

4. sustainable Furniture and green Materials

  • Recycled-content​ desks, ​chairs, and whiteboards limit environmental impact while ⁣supporting eco-friendly procurement policies.
  • Modular, adaptable furniture promotes flexible, collaborative learning⁤ spaces and lifetime ⁤reusability.
  • Low-VOC paints and non-toxic materials ensure safer indoor environments for students and staff.

5. Virtual and Augmented Reality for ​Green Education

  • VR and AR platforms ‍ let students explore ecosystems, renewable energy plants, and‍ sustainable cities—without physical field trips‍ or extra⁤ carbon​ emissions.
  • Interactive, simulation-based ​learning enhances understanding of environmental‍ science,‍ climate change, and sustainability.

6. E-Waste Management and ​Device recycling⁢ Programs

  • Certified IT asset⁤ disposition (ITAD) partners ⁢help schools recycle obsolete devices responsibly, diverting electronics from landfills ⁤and ​recovering valuable materials.
  • Device donation schemes ⁤ extend ‍the⁤ lifecycle of technology, reducing demand for new manufacturing.

Case Studies: Sustainable Technology in​ Action

Finland’s Green Digital classrooms

finland, renowned for its progressive education system, invested in⁢ solar panels across hundreds of schools, powering⁤ smart ‍boards and digital devices used daily. With ‍cloud-based digital textbooks, paper use ⁣dropped by 60%, while energy bills ⁣fell sharply thanks to IoT-driven building‍ management ​systems.

California’s Flexible, Low-Carbon​ Learning Spaces

Several‍ California school districts combined recycled-content furnishings ⁤with advanced VR labs. These schools saw a boost in collaborative projects and STEM engagement, ​as well as reduced landfill waste from ⁤furniture ​turnover and device upgrades, all underpinned by⁢ extensive ‌e-waste‌ management strategies.

India’s Solar-Powered Rural Schools

In energy-challenged rural areas, solar-powered classrooms are transforming‍ learning. Students now ⁢access interactive e-learning platforms on ‍donated tablets‍ while solar panels⁤ ensure all-day internet and‍ lighting—paving the way for digital literacy ⁣and sustainability education.

practical tips for Integrating Sustainable​ Technology in Your⁣ Classroom

  • Start ‍small: Begin with affordable, high-impact shifts, such as⁤ LED lightbulbs or cloud-based resources, before larger investments.
  • engage Stakeholders: Involve students, parents, and staff in technology planning and sustainability awareness campaigns.
  • Pilot ⁣New ‍Solutions: Test new platforms or eco-friendly products in select classrooms to measure impact and gather⁣ feedback before scaling up.
  • Partner with Local Green Businesses: Collaborate with local vendors ‌for certified sustainable products⁣ and services.
  • Implement Device Recycling‍ Drives: ‍ Run⁤ regular⁢ campaigns to collect and responsibly recycle outdated electronics.

Overcoming ⁣Challenges

  • Funding: Access grants and green financing options for initial investments⁤ in renewable energy and digital ‌upgrades.
  • Teacher⁤ Training: Invest in ⁢professional development to help⁣ educators seamlessly integrate new technology into their teaching.
  • Equity: ⁢ Ensure that all students—regardless of ​background—can benefit from sustainable classroom innovations.
